Output dcbfa39353feec9ca9518ba2010d405366e5c443ff8634210df3b24dff790522:58

value
560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a759f9c7b0bbb25e6604fa595b02bf1f37d6f4a OP_EQUAL
address
38UiqMwvkb1JMeLT2FnRNB5MMhkTRNNEj2
transaction
dcbfa39353feec9ca9518ba2010d405366e5c443ff8634210df3b24dff790522
confirmations
281804
spent
true